Activating Licensed Features

In order to enable advanced features, such as advanced routing protocols, you must purchase and 
activate a license key. If you have purchased a license, you can proceed to activate your license as 
described in this section. If you wish to purchase a license, use the Enterasys Customer Portal or 
contact the Enterasys Networks Sales Department.

Purpose

To activate and verify licensed features.

license advanced
When an advanced license is available, use this command to activate licensed features. If this is 
available on your SecureStack C2 switch, a unique license key will display in the show license 
command output.
Syntax
license advanced activation-key
Parameters
activation‐key

Specifies your unique 16‐digit hexadecimal advanced licensing key.
